虚拟主机IP地址是否相同? (虚拟主机ip是一样吗)
在如今的网络世界里,虚拟主机已经成为了大多数中小型企业托管网站的首选。虚拟主机利用一个物理主机来托管多个虚拟主机,而这些虚拟主机共享同一个IP地址。那么,虚拟主机IP地址是否相同呢?这是一个非常重要的问题,特别是对于那些有多个托管网站的企业来说。
要回答这个问题,首先我们需要了解一下虚拟主机的基本概念。虚拟主机是指在一台服务器上通过划分资源来托管多个网站,不同的虚拟主机之间彼此独立,互不影响。虚拟主机可以通过不同的技术实现,如IP-based虚拟主机和Name-based虚拟主机。
IP-based虚拟主机是指为每个虚拟主机分配一个独立的IP地址。每个虚拟主机绑定到一个唯一的IP地址,这样客户端就可以通过这个IP地址直接访问到特定的网站。这种方式可以确保不同虚拟主机之间的资源是独立的,而且可以使用不同的SSL证书。
另一种虚拟主机技术是Name-based虚拟主机,是通过在同一个IP地址下使用不同的域名来托管多个虚拟主机。当客户端向服务器请求访问某个网站时,服务器会根据请求的域名确定客户端要访问的是哪个虚拟主机。这种方式比较常见,具有灵活性,而且可以减少IP地址的使用。
那么,虚拟主机IP地址是否相同呢?答案是,这取决于使用的虚拟主机技术。IP-based虚拟主机每个虚拟主机都有独立的IP地址,因此IP地址是不相同的。而Name-based虚拟主机的虚拟主机共享同一个IP地址,因此IP地址是相同的。
当然,虚拟主机IP地址是否相同并不影响网站的访问,因为服务器会根据请求的域名分配到正确的虚拟主机。但是,在一些情况下,IP地址可能是关键因素。例如,某些搜索引擎可能会将相同IP地址下的网站视为同一网站,这可能会影响SEO排名。另外,如果您需要使用SSL证书,则必须使用IP-based虚拟主机,因为Name-based虚拟主机不支持多个SSL证书。
综上所述,虚拟主机IP地址是否相同取决于使用的虚拟主机技术。IP-based虚拟主机每个虚拟主机都有独立的IP地址,而Name-based虚拟主机的虚拟主机共享同一个IP地址。实际应用中需要根据具体需求来选择虚拟主机技术,以达到更佳的效果。